Garifield Terrace — HUD inspection scores

Public housing · 2371 11th St Nw Apt 21, Washington, DC 20001

Latest published score NSPIRE
43 Failing
out of 100 Inspected March 26, 2024

Scores higher than 6% of Washington DC’s 200 currently scored properties · state median 90

Under NSPIRE, a score below 60 is failing; 60–79 puts a property on a more frequent inspection cycle.

Inspection date Score Standard
March 26, 2024 43 NSPIRE
July 18, 2022 44 REAC (UPCS)
December 7, 2017 36 REAC (UPCS)
September 8, 2015 58 REAC (UPCS)
November 20, 2014 45 REAC (UPCS)
October 28, 2013 53 REAC (UPCS)
November 13, 2008 58.36 REAC (UPCS)

HUD's published files sample the record: each snapshot carries a property's latest score at publication, so an inspection can be missing between snapshots, and no inspections conducted 2010–2012 appear in any file HUD still publishes. History here is assembled from every file HUD offers.
